Actually, its D. [They were from different geographic and cultural parts of Spain.] Thing was, Ferdinand was the King of Aragon, and Isabel was the Queen of Castille. Once Spain was unified, they could work to their main goal as king and king, which was to push Muslim control out of Spain. And to this, they did.
